How does Lincoln Town Car air suspension work?

A Lincoln Town Car's air suspension uses a small, separate air compressor under the driver's side left fenderwell, and air lines run to the air bags. On top of each air bag is a electrical valve that serves as a relief valve that allows air to be exhausted when activated.

How do I know if my air suspension is bad?

Common signs include the rear feeling loose or spongy, a bouncy or rough ride, the air compressor running frequently, and sagging on one side.

What happens when air suspension fails?

Common Air Suspension Problems

When air suspension fails, you'll know it. The most likely first symptoms are a lower, sagging ride height, or the selectable ride settings that no longer function. Other symptoms include a rougher, noisier ride, and sloppy handling through corners and over bumps.

What happens if you lift a car with air suspension?

You have to turn off the air suspension to jack the car up or to pick it up with a lift. Very dangerous NOT to do this as the airbags that are an integral part of the air suspension are constantly checked by one of the onboard computers and will adjust whether or not the car is running.

Can you jack up car with air suspension?

Yes, go to off-road height before jacking as the suspension has a lot of "reach", especially the rear suspension. Make sure you use the rear parking brake and block the front wheels too.
